Out and About: A First Book of Poems

Review
This is the first U.S. edition of a book first published in Great Britain in 1988. The collection is arranged into the four seasons of the year and it highlights what small children may find in each season when they are out and about. The pen and ink drawings are unmistakably Shirley Hughes. In an author's note Hughes says that for her, words and pictures go together. They do so here harmoniously and create a delightful first book of poems for three to five year olds. Recommended and what a great gift book it makes too!
